Doha:  Doha Golf Club which last week played host to the world’s leading golfers at the Commercial Bank Qatar Masters - European Tour event – will welcome some of the top amateur men and women players during the Bonallack and Patsy Hankins tournaments.
The two events, to be held from March 8-10 at the Peter Harradine designed course, will pit the best of male and female amateur European players against an Asia-Pacific team.
The men will be vying for the Bonallack Trophy while the women for the Patsy Hankins honours in the three-day tournament.
Two teams of twelve representing Europe and Asia- Pacific will be vying for top honours in the tournament which will be played in match-play format.
The first two days, of the three days format, will comprise five foursomes matches each morning and five four-ball matches each afternoon.
On the final day, all twelve team players will compete in singles match play.
A win will count as one point, a half yields half a point and a lost match will return zero. In the event of a tie, the trophy shall be retained by the holders.
 The World Amateur Golf Ranking will be used as the main reference in addition to a number of captain’s picks. According to the match conditions, no more than two players may be selected from the same country.
Meanwhile, Europe has announced its team.
European Team: Edgar Catherine (France), Todd Clements (England), Robin Dawson (Ireland), Oliver Gillberg (Sweden), Marc Hammer (Germany), Rasmus Hojgaard (Denmark), Matias Honkala (Finland), Angel Hidalgo Portillo (Spain), Matthew Jordan (England), Frederic Lacroix (France), Kristoffer Reitan (Norway), Sami Valimaki (Finland).
